Vegas Pro 18 - Move the pan point to a corner … WebWhat are the general functions of CN IX? 1) Motor to the stylopharyngeus muscle. 2) Sensory to tongue, pharynx. Taste, salivation, gag reflex, swallowing. What type of nerve is CN IX? Mixed. What is the central connection of CN IX? Nucleus in medulla. What is the peripheral distribution of CN IX?

WebNov 7, 2024 · The glossopharyngeal nerve is the 9th cranial nerve (CN IX). It is one of the four cranial nerves that has sensory, motor, and parasympathetic functions. It originates from the medulla oblongata and … WebCranial Nerve 9 & 10- Sensory and Motor: Gag Reflex Using a tongue blade, the left side of the patient's palate is touched which results in a gag reflex with the left side of the palate elevating more then the right and the uvula deviating to the left consistent with a right CN 9 & 10 deficit.
